Outback Potato Soup: A Comforting Easy Recipe with Turkey Bacon

Outback Potato Soup

A creamy and hearty potato soup featuring turkey bacon for a comforting meal.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 large potatoes
  • 6 slices turkey bacon
  • 1 medium onion
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 cup green onions

Instructions

  1. Cook the turkey bacon in a large pot until crispy. Remove and chop.
  2. In the same pot, sauté the onion and garlic until softened.
  3. Add the diced potatoes and chicken broth. Bring to a boil, then simmer until potatoes are tender.
  4. Mash the potatoes slightly for a thicker texture.
  5. Stir in the heavy cream, salt, and pepper. Cook for an additional 5 minutes.
  6. Serve hot, garnished with chopped turkey bacon and green onions.

Notes

  • For a thicker soup, blend a portion of the soup and mix back in.
  • Top with shredded cheese for extra flavor.
